Baby Luggage
Dept. of Strange Security Procedures.
A woman has 14-month-old twin boys. They had a flight recently (I believe out of Atlanta Hartsfield Jackson International Airport, Hair Care Salon, and Quick Lube Station). The boys — remember, 14 months old — were each classified by security as “single male, no baggage” and treated accordingly — i.e. they were searched and “wanded”.
